Subject: [PATCH] nat/linux-ptrace.c: add missing gdb_byte* cast
|
||||
|
||||
On noMMU platforms, the following code gets compiled:
|
||||
|
||||
child_stack = xmalloc (STACK_SIZE * 4);
|
||||
|
||||
Where child_stack is a gdb_byte*, and xmalloc() returns a void*. While
|
||||
the lack of cast is valid in C, it is not in C++, causing the
|
||||
following build failure:
|
||||
|
||||
../nat/linux-ptrace.c: In function 'int linux_fork_to_function(gdb_byte*, int (*)(void*))':
|
||||
../nat/linux-ptrace.c:273:29: error: invalid conversion from 'void*' to 'gdb_byte* {aka unsigned char*}' [-fpermissive]
|
||||
child_stack = xmalloc (STACK_SIZE * 4);
|
||||
|
||||
Therefore, this commit adds the appropriate cast.
